Job Title: Club Director

Are you passionate about making a difference in the lives of young people? Do you have a strong background in youth development and leadership? We are seeking a highly motivated and experienced Club Director to join our team at Boys & Girls Clubs of Middle Tennessee.

Job Summary:

The Club Director is responsible for directing and managing the overall daily operations of our Club. This includes providing leadership, direction, supervision, and evaluation of Club staff regarding program development and staff management. The successful candidate will have a strong understanding of youth development principles and be able to create a positive and supportive environment for our members.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Assume ultimate responsibility for all staff activities, programs, and operational functions related to the Club location
  • Assist in the development and implementation of organization-wide programs, trainings, events, and other assignments as needed
  • Build a strong working team at the Club with staff empowered to achieve program objectives and outcomes
  • Create a warm, positive environment that helps achieve youth development outcomes
  • Implement Club programs, activities, and services that prepare youth for success, as well as, accomplish and exceed the minimum standards determined by the organization
  • Ensure that all programmatic and operational data required by the organization is being collected, tracked, and accurately reported in a timely manner
  • Ensure a healthy and safe environment while maintaining facilities, equipment, and supplies
  • Maintain close communications with Club staff
  • Explain and discuss organizational mission, program objectives, standards, and issues
  • Maintain close contact with the Chief Executive Officer (CEO), Chief Operating Officer (COO), Chief Development Officer (CDO), Chief Financial Officer (CFO), and other management staff in order to achieve organizational mission
  • Complete and implement the Impact Assessment planning tool provided by Boys & Girls Clubs of America throughout the calendar year
  • Complete Boys & Girls Clubs of America's Annual Report as it pertains to the Club location
  • Compile required reports reflecting all activities, attendance, and participation
  • Organize and document all programs for the planned year
  • Manage Club financial resources and development of annual budgets. Control expenditures against budget
  • Ensure administrative and operational systems are in place to maintain the operation of the physical properties and equipment. Ensure compliance with organization policies
  • Follow policies and procedure in purchasing of supplies and equipment
  • Provide leadership and support to Board members in obtaining fundraising goals in order to meet the Club's yearly budget
  • Recruit, manage, and engage volunteers
  • Maintain a current professional development plan for each full-time and part-time staff
  • Provide Club-specific orientation to all new and seasonal employees, coordinating with the COO & Director of Operations who has overall responsibility for orientation
  • Conduct regular staff meetings to discuss program outcomes, assigned tasks, Club procedures, and individual youth development and organization policies
  • Allocate and monitor work assigned to program staff and volunteers, providing ongoing feedback and regular appraisal; Identify and support training and development opportunities for assigned volunteers and staff
  • Oversee proper record-keeping and reporting including activities and events conducted, breakdowns of daily participation figures, notable achievements, and any problem/issues
  • Ensure productive and effective performance by all program staff and volunteers
  • Develop and maintain public relations to increase the visibility of programs and services within the Club community
  • Work with the Director of Marketing and Events to publicize activities of the Club
  • Develop partnerships with parents, community leaders, and organizations in order to enhance program goals and objectives
  • Maintain contact with external community groups, schools, members' parents, and others to assist in resolving issues and to publicize Club programs
  • Obtain your CDL Class B with a P Endorsement within 90 days of your hire date
Requirements:
  • Four-year degree from an accredited college or university, or equivalent experience
  • A minimum of five years work experience in a Boys & Girls Club or similar organization, planning and supervising activities based on the developmental needs of young people, or equivalent experience
  • Demonstrated ability to critically think through issues, resolve problems, and solution-oriented
  • Demonstrated ability to recruit new members and retain existing members
  • Demonstrated ability in personnel supervision, facilities management, including fixtures, equipment, and building maintenance, and retention of key personnel
  • Knowledge of 21st Century educational grant preferred
  • Strong communication skills, both oral and written
  • Ability to deal effectively with members, including discipline problems
  • Working knowledge of budget preparation, control, and management
  • Demonstrated ability in working with young people, parents, and community leaders
  • Demonstrated knowledge of principles related to youth development, partnership development, and group leadership skills
  • Possession of a valid state driver's license and ability to obtain CDL license
  • Meet the eligibility of insurance company regulations for operating Club vehicles
  • Proficient in Internet use and Microsoft Office products
  • Possession of or ability to obtain CPR and First Aid Certifications
  • Ability to pass a background check and physical examination
